Topic: Opinion on the Mad River Outrage for 5 ft 8 in 175 lb padd
Replies: 13
Views: 6159

Outrage

I'm working on my third one. I'm 5'6" and about your weight. I find it to do everything well. It's a good big water as well as technical boat. i find it stable as well.
If you get one and don't like it they sell fast too.

Topic: Mohawk Scamp??
Replies: 5
Views: 4997

Scamp

When Whitesel first started out he used Mohawks facilities/equipment to mold his boats. The Scamp was his first effort(?). The Scamps bow and stern were pulled in unlike the Whitesel's which were probably pulled out 4". I had one in the day and widened the ends . It did very well for then. I had it ...
